Synopsis

In 3×3, the recent work of Seattle-based architecture firm Suyama Peterson Deguchi is broken down into a case study of three recently constructed residences. Sharing inherent architectonic characteristics and employing similar design philosophies, these homes are tested on three different kinds of sites and topographies: a remote island getaway, perched high along a rocky bluff affording “big” views of the archipelago below; a long and narrow site in an historic beach community on Puget Sound; and a site situated on a golf course fairway, surrounded by homes built in more traditional styles.
